8-) Okay. When you get a chance, you might like to try on the 
ethernet-bearing computer - connect the modem to the ethernet port and 
to the phone line, and then run the Mandrake Control Centre tool to set 
up the connection. <goes and looks> It's something I don't usually do 
at the GUI, sorry!

If you've already done this on that computer, you might need to 
re-configure rather than configure a new one; you need to know how many 
ethernet cards/ports you have, and that's really all. Make sure you 
select Dynamic Host Configuration Protocol (that means let the modem do 
the work of giving you an IP address), and make sure if you've got two 
ethernet ports that you pick the one you're plugged into! 

Then you ought to be able to browse to the modem using 10.0.0.1.
